Glossary

AE (or Ã?)  It refers to a coin which does not contain silver or  gold – ie which is struck from brass, bronze or copper. It is derived from aes, the Latin for bronze.
Alloy  The mixture of two or more metals.
AR(or AR conjoined)

The abbreviation for silver. It is derived from  argentum, the Latin for silver.

Assay

An analytical test to ascertain the purity of precious metals.

AV (or AV conjoined)

The abbreviation for gold. It is derived from aureus, the Latin for gold.
